I know you welders out there(frederic :D ) would simply weld stuff together but for you guys who can't, this might be the ticket. Its called 80/20. Its an aluminum Tslot extrusion and accessories to build framing systems or whatever for lots of different applications.. Only limited by your imagination. A lot of CNC people use it for their DIY CNC's. Anyway, thought I'd post it, as its not a well known product outside of the metalworking industry.
